Abstract

The invention relates to a medical apparatus, and specifically relates to an intelligent anti-breaking orthopedic steel plate. The steel plate comprises a steel plate body. The steel plate body is provided with a trigger switch, a trigger rod installed cooperated with the trigger switch, a drive circuit electrically connected with the trigger switch, and a vibrator and an electric injection pump connected with the output ends of the drive circuit. The orthopedic steel plate is simple in structure and convenient in use. The arrangement of the trigger rod is beneficial for dispersing stress of the steel plate, and bending pressure resistance is improved. In addition, when the steel plate bends excessively, an alarm prompt device prompts patients, so as to prevent the steel plate from being broken because of excessive stress. The orthopedic steel plate is beneficial for reducing doctor-patient disputes.

Description

The anti-breaking orthopedic steel plate of intelligence
Technical field
The present invention relates to a kind of medical apparatus and instruments, is a kind of intelligent anti-breaking orthopedic steel plate specifically.
Background technology
Modern medicine often will use orthopedic steel plate when treating fracture patient, utilizes orthopedic steel plate to be fixed by the knochenbruch of patient.Because recovery time is long, during bone healing, patient can move, simultaneously in order to avoid amyotrophy, appropriate motion has facilitation for the recovery of patient, but the activity of patient can cause steel plate, and over-burden or cause steel plate fatigability to rupture owing to moving frequently, although doctor can enjoin patient not to be engaged in strenuous exercise and activity too frequently, owing to not having quantitative index and checkout gear, patient is difficult to grasp suitable quantity of motion.When quantity of motion exceedes the ability to bear of steel plate, steel plate will rupture, and causes extra injury to patient.When the stressed bending of this steel plate, bending part concentrates on a bit usually, is easy to overbending occurs or fractures because of mechanical fatigue.
Summary of the invention
The object of this invention is to provide the orthopedic steel plate that a kind of structure is simple, easy to use, can point out to patient when steel plate bending is excessive, thus avoid steel plate because of stressed excessive and rupture.
For achieving the above object, the present invention adopts following technical scheme:
The anti-breaking orthopedic steel plate of intelligence of the present invention comprises steel plate body, vibrator and the motorised syringe pump of the drive circuit outfan that described steel plate body is provided with trigger switch, coordinates the frizzen installed, the drive circuit be electrically connected with trigger switch with trigger switch, is connected to.
Described steel plate body is provided with ball-and-socket, and trigger switch is arranged on the inwall of described ball-and-socket; Described frizzen is fixedly connected on steel plate body by anchor pole, and frizzen is provided with the touch pole perpendicular to steel plate body, and the top of described touch pole is provided with the bulb be arranged in ball-and-socket.
Described frizzen is strip cylinder, steel plate body is provided with strip groove, described strip groove is arranged along the length direction of steel plate body, and frizzen is inlaid in described strip groove, and described trigger switch is arranged between the inwall of frizzen and described strip groove.
Adopt after technique scheme, this orthopedic steel plate structure is simple, easy to use, and it is stressed that being provided with of frizzen is beneficial to dispersion steel plate, improves bending voltage endurance capability.In addition, when steel plate bending is excessive, alarm device can be pointed out to patient, thus avoids steel plate because of stressed excessive and rupture, and is conducive to the generation reducing doctor-patient dispute.

Detailed description of the invention
As shown in Figure 1, the anti-breaking orthopedic steel plate of intelligence of the present invention comprises steel plate body 1, vibrator 5 and the motorised syringe pump 6 of drive circuit 4 outfan that described steel plate body 1 is provided with trigger switch 2, coordinates the frizzen 3 installed, the drive circuit 4 be electrically connected with trigger switch 2 with trigger switch 2, is connected to.The input of motorised syringe pump 6 is connected to pain liquid reservoir by check valve, in pain liquid reservoir, the injection making people produce pain is housed, the outfan of motorised syringe pump 6 connects the syringe of implant into body, injection in pain liquid reservoir can be injected human body during motorised syringe pump 6 action, make people produce pain, remind patient.The effect of drive circuit 4 is the signals receiving trigger switch 2, and drive vibrator 5 and motorised syringe pump 6 action when receiving the actuating signal of trigger switch 2, described drive circuit 4, vibrator 5 and motorised syringe pump 6 are prior art, do not do more description at this.
As shown in Figure 2 and Figure 3, as one embodiment of the present of invention, described steel plate body 1 is provided with ball-and-socket, trigger switch 2 is arranged on the inwall of described ball-and-socket, trigger switch 2 can adopt microswitch, also can adopt thin film switch, when having multiple ball-and-socket or multiple trigger switch, can by multiple trigger switch with or logical structure in parallel, as long as namely have a trigger switch 2 to trigger can cause follow-up action; Described frizzen 3 is fixedly connected on steel plate body 1 by anchor pole 31, frizzen 3 is at least arranged two anchor poles 31, is stably set in parallel on steel plate body 1 by frizzen 3.Frizzen 3 is provided with the touch pole 32 perpendicular to steel plate body 1, and the top of described touch pole 32 is provided with the bulb 33 be arranged in ball-and-socket.When under the normal condition that steel plate body 1 keeps straight, bulb 33 is positioned at the middle of ball-and-socket, can not oppress trigger switch 2.When steel plate body 1 stressed bending time, the parallel relation between steel plate body 1 and frizzen 3 must be broken, touch one of them trigger switch 2, the signal that trigger switch 2 produces controls vibrator 5 and motorised syringe pump 6 action through drive circuit 4, the vibrations that vibrator 5 produces and the pain that the injection that motorised syringe pump 6 injects produces can remind patient to note the amplitude of moving, and the state of timely medical check steel plate.
Certainly, above-mentioned bulb 33 can be discoid or rectangular disk as shown in Figure 3, and ball-and-socket is the disc that matches or square; Bulb 33 also can adopt spheroid or hemisphere, and ball-and-socket is then the spherical or hemispherical matched.
As shown in Figure 4, Figure 5, as an alternative embodiment of the invention, described frizzen 3 is strip cylinder, steel plate body 1 is provided with strip groove, described strip groove is arranged along the length direction of steel plate body 1, frizzen 3 is inlaid in described strip groove, and described trigger switch 2 is arranged between the inwall of frizzen 3 and described strip groove.This spline structure is compacter, and sensitivity is higher.
The setting of frizzen also helps and disperses steel plate stressed, improves bending voltage endurance capability.
